Warning Signs You Need Gray Water Extraction (Category 2)

Gray water extraction is a serious issue that needs immediate attention. If you notice any of the following warning signs, don’t hesitate to call our team for help. The sooner you act, the better.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of gray water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home or business,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your flooring,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t wait, it could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Water Stains or Spots

Water stains or spots on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of gray water damage. If you notice any water marks or discoloration,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t wait, it could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of gray water damage.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ore it, it could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Water-Soaked Insulation

Water-soaked insulation can be a sign of gray water damage. If you notice any signs of water-logged insulation,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t wait, it could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ill Yes No DIY is fine for small water spills, but for larger issues, it’s best to call a pro.
Category 2 water damage No Yes Category 2 water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water damage in a large area No Yes Water damage in a large area needs professional equipment and expertise to restore your property safely and efficiently.
Water damage with m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s professional attention to prevent further health risks and ensure a safe living or working environment.
Water damage with electrical issues No Yes Water damage with electrical issues need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living or working environment.
Water damage with structural issues No Yes Water damage with structural issues need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living or working environment.

With gray water extraction, it’s always best to err on the side of caution. If you’re unsure about the severity of the damage or the best course of action, call a professional to ensure your property is restored safely and efficiently.

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) Cost In San Juan Capistrano, CA

The cost of gray water extraction in San Juan Capistrano,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ule an appointment and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Water Damage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area, local conditions
Structural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Contents Cleaning and Restoration $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
